Belgian cops on Thursday robbed a number of addresses in the nation as component of a probe right into claimed corruption “under the guise of commercial lobbying”, district attorneys claimed.

Several individuals were held for examining over their “alleged involvement in active corruption within the European Parliament, as well as for forgery and use of forgeries,” the government district attorney’s workplace claimed.

About 100 policemans participated in the procedure that saw a total amount of 21 searches performed throughout Belgium and in Portugal, it included.

Belgian paper Le Soir and investigatory web site Follow the Money (FTM) claimed the probe was connected to Chinese technology titan Huawei and its tasks in Brussels considering that 2021.

Huawei did not promptly reply to AFP’s ask for remark.

The raids come greater than 2 years after the “Qatargate” rumor, in which a variety of EU legislators were implicated of being paid to advertise the passions of Qatar and Morocco– something both nations have actually vigorously refuted.

The district attorney’s workplace provided no information regarding the people or firms included.

But it claimed the claimed corruption by a “criminal organisation” was “practised regularly and very discreetly from 2021 to the present day” and took “various forms”.

These consisted of “remuneration for taking political positions or excessive gifts such as food and travel expenses or regular invitations to football matches” as component of a quote to advertise “purely private commercial interests” in political choices.

The declared kickbacks were hidden as meeting expenditures and paid to numerous middlemans, the workplace claimed, including it was considering whether cash laundering had actually likewise been included.

At the heart of the claimed corruption is an ex-parliamentary aide that was utilized at the time as Huawei’s EU public events supervisor, Belgian media claimed.

Le Soir claimed cops had actually taken “several lobbyists” right into guardianship and they resulted from show up before a court for examining.

None of those held for examining on Thursday early morning were EU legislators, a cops resource informed AFP.

A speaker for the European Parliament informed AFP that it “takes note of the information. When requested it always cooperates fully with the judicial authorities”.
